Transaction 169d84089a45e8b0f672f79d0f9afc61afe7f31c24be91a14a17a57be11a3652

block
a62c725dd8843a645452cda11144ef74512c93bdb753afdd80a4ca0098a397f5

1 Input

23 Outputs